IE瀏覽器與CSS的兼容策略
在現(xiàn)代網(wǎng)頁開發(fā)中,確保不同瀏覽器間的兼容性***關重要,對于Internet Explorer(IE)瀏覽器,由于其版本眾多且部分舊版本對CSS的支持存在差異,因此我們需要采取特定的策略來確保良好的CSS兼容性。
一、了解IE版本
了解目標用戶的IE版本分布,因為隨著Edge瀏覽器的推出,大多數(shù)用戶已經(jīng)轉(zhuǎn)向更新版本的瀏覽器,在一些組織或特定地區(qū),舊版IE瀏覽器的使用仍然較為普遍,了解哪些版本是你需要關注的重點***關重要。
二、使用漸進增強策略
采用漸進增強策略,即先確保基本功能在所有瀏覽器上都能正常工作,然后再針對現(xiàn)代瀏覽器添加***功能和樣式,這樣即使在不支持***新CSS特性的舊版IE瀏覽器上,用戶依然可以訪問基礎內(nèi)容。
三 合理使用條件注釋
條件注釋是IE瀏覽器特有的功能,允許***針對不同版本的IE瀏覽器加載不同的樣式或腳本,利用條件注釋,可以為舊版IE瀏覽器提供特定的CSS樣式表或腳本修復方案。
四、使用兼容性工具和庫
利用現(xiàn)代前端工具如PostCSS和Autoprefixer等,可以自動處理CSS的兼容性問題,這些工具能夠根據(jù)目標瀏覽器自動添加前綴或修改代碼,以確保在不同瀏覽器上的兼容性,一些特定的庫如Modernizr可以幫助檢測瀏覽器功能并提供相應的類來確保兼容性。
五、避免使用過時和不兼容的CSS特性
在設計網(wǎng)頁時,盡量避免使用那些已知在某些版本的IE瀏覽器中不支持的CSS特性,如果必須使用這些特性,考慮使用降級策略或提供替代方案以確保在舊版IE瀏覽器上的兼容性。
確保IE瀏覽器的CSS兼容性需要綜合考慮多種策略和方法,通過了解用戶使用的瀏覽器版本、采用漸進增強策略、合理使用條件注釋、利用兼容性工具和庫以及避免使用不兼容的CSS特性,我們可以大大提高網(wǎng)頁在IE瀏覽器上的兼容性。